[Research progress on pathogenesis of malignant mesothelioma]
1Department of Pathology, The People's Hospital of Chuxiong Yi Autonomous Prefecture, Chuxiong 675000, China.
Summary
Asbestos exposure causes malignant mesothelioma. Research reveals molecular changes like gene mutations and chromosome alterations, crucial for understanding and treating this cancer.
Area of Science:
- Oncology and Environmental Health
Background:
- Malignant mesothelioma is strongly linked to asbestos exposure.
- Understanding its molecular underpinnings is key to improving patient outcomes.
Approach:
- This review synthesizes current research on mesothelioma pathogenesis.
- Focuses on molecular alterations including chromosomal changes, gene mutations, and miRNA expression.
Key Points:
- Malignant mesothelioma exhibits significant chromosomal alterations, gene mutations, and deletions.
- Recent studies highlight targeted mutations in tumor suppressor genes and altered signaling pathways.
- MicroRNA (miRNA) dysregulation is increasingly recognized in mesothelioma development.
Conclusions:
- Continued exploration of mesothelioma's molecular pathogenesis is vital.
- This knowledge aids in early diagnosis, effective treatment strategies, and prognosis prediction.
